O’Sullivan to meet Campbell in first round

Draw made for first round of snooker’s world championship

Ronnie O’Sullivan will begin the defence of his World Championship title against Scotland’s Marcus Campbell.

O’Sullivan was initially slated to miss the competition at the Crucible in Sheffield, pulling out of the rest of the 2012-13 season last November due to “personal issues”, but he ended his sabbatical in February.

He will be chasing a fifth world title and, despite a significant time away from the game, the 37-year-old will be confident of defeating Campbell, whose best result came when he defeated Stephen Hendry 9-0 in the 1998 UK Championship.

Matthew Selt, who say off Ken Doherty in the final round of the qualifiers, earns a meeting with Mark Selby.
